Survey Purpose & Context

3

• Conduct a credible study of market prices in each region of the state and across all program types to assist EEC in evaluating the adequacy of rates for the purpose of demonstrating equal access to child care for low-income families. The study: o Examines the market prices for each type of care within each region

and compare to EEC reimbursement rates to assess adequacy of rateso Highlights significant price variations o Examines workforce staff make-up and qualifications

• EEC’s target child care rate schedule is to meet the 75th percentile of market prices

• ACF federal rules targets a goal of establishing rates at least at the 75 th percentile to be regarded as providing equal access

Survey Methodology

5

o Based on a random sample of 4,421 child care centers, family child care providers and out-of-school-time programs

o Survey administered on-line in English and Spanish, with follow-up phone calls conducted by Mass211 data collection team

o Survey Responses:o 2,100 programs participated in the survey o Response rate of 89% for center-based and out-of-school-time

programs and 59% for family child care providerso 11% refused to participate and 30% did not respondo 95% confidence level, confidence intervals between 3.8 and 5.6

Results of Market Price Survey Family Child Care

10

Region Age Group EEC Rate25th Percentile

50th Percentile

75th Percentile

EEC Market Access Rate

Western

Infant $30.10 $32.00 $35.00 $40.00 22.1%

Toddler $30.10 $30.00 $35.00 $40.00 33.3%

Preschool $26.40 $30.00 $35.00 $40.00 9.5%

Central

Infant $31.80 $33.00 $40.00 $45.00 17.1%

Toddler $31.80 $32.00 $40.00 $45.00 24.5%

Preschool $26.40 $30.00 $40.00 $45.00 9.3%

Northeastern

Infant $31.50 $34.25 $45.00 $50.05 18.5%

Toddler $31.50 $32.50 $44.00 $54.37 22.8%

Preschool $27.85 $30.00 $40.00 $50.00 15.4%

Metro

Infant $34.35 $45.00 $56.50 $65.00 3.8%

Toddler $34.35 $41.50 $55.00 $65.00 8.5%

Preschool $27.85 $41.50 $55.00 $65.25 8.1%

Southeastern

Infant $31.80 $35.00 $40.00 $45.00 8.1%

Toddler $31.80 $35.00 $40.00 $45.00 17.6%

Preschool $26.40 $30.00 $38.00 $54.75 3.7%

Boston

Infant $31.50 $32.00 $40.00 $54.50 17.4%

Toddler $31.50 $30.00 $40.00 $51.50 31.1%

Preschool $27.85 $30.00 $38.00 $53.88 11.5%

Results of Market Price Survey Out of School

14

Region Age Group EEC Rate25th

Percentile50th

Percentile75th

PercentileEEC Market Access

Rate

Western

Before School $7.25 $6.77 $8.00 $10.00 34.6%After School $15.25 $14.16 $15.00 $18.50 60.0%Full Day Holiday $30.70 $29.00 $30.70 $34.00 50.0%Full Day Summer $30.70 $30.00 $33.45 $35.25 37.1%

Central

Before School $7.25 $7.63 $9.97 $10.92 21.4%After School $15.25 $14.00 $18.68 $21.00 28.7%Full Day Holiday $30.70 $33.00 $35.00 $42.04 18.5%Full Day Summer $30.70 $27.60 $35.00 $36.49 33.5%

Northeastern

Before School $7.70 $11.60 $20.00 $42.00 4.1%After School $17.05 $17.55 $21.60 $24.95 22.1%Full Day Holiday $31.75 $30.75 $40.00 $50.00 26.1%Full Day Summer $31.75 $36.00 $44.00 $50.00 16.7%

Metro

Before School $7.90 $8.75 $11.13 $32.42 19.3%After School $17.50 $18.68 $22.15 $27.00 12.0%Full Day Holiday $32.65 $28.60 $49.50 $64.15 27.1%Full Day Summer $32.65 $31.80 $41.00 $52.50 26.2%

Southeastern

Before School $7.25 $9.75 $16.75 $19.06 4.7%After School $15.25 $17.00 $19.00 $25.00 13.5%Full Day Holiday $30.70 $30.00 $38.00 $40.00 27.0%Full Day Summer $30.70 $30.00 $35.00 $38.00 29.3%

Boston

Before School $7.90 $7.95 $8.80 $9.50 16.6%After School $17.50 $15.70 $19.00 $22.00 30.7%Full Day Holiday $32.65 $22.08 $30.00 $37.50 68.2%Full Day Summer $32.65 $28.75 $31.77 $40.75 51.3%

Results of Market Price Survey Key findings

19

• Prices for center-based care and family child care are highest in the Metro, Boston and Northeastern regions

• Reimbursement rates are significantly below the 75th price percentiles for all age groups in all regions of the state

• Consistent with 2010 results, prices decreased significantly in center-based settings as the age of the child increases, while prices in family child care settings decrease less as the age of child increases

• The price changes for family child care since 2010 were less significant than those from 2008-2010 reported in the last market price survey

• A comparison of EEC after-school rates and market prices finds that reimbursement rates are below the 75th price percentiles in all regions and are below the 50th percentiles in all regions, except for the Western Region

• EEC rates are above the 25th percentile for after-school care in only three regions.
